Damage to the eye's optic nerve causes the eye ailment glaucoma. The optic nerve transmits visual information from the eyes to the brain, making it a crucial component of the human eye. Glaucoma often develops when fluid in the eye builds up and creates excessive pressure, which harms the optic nerve. Age-related glaucoma is the second leading cause of blindness after cataracts.

The signs and symptoms of glaucoma

  • Nausea and vomiting
  • Headache
  • Eye pain
  • Red eye
  • Blurred, low, or narrow vision or blind spot
  • Creating haloes and glare around the light source

Who have risk of glaucoma?

  • Genetic causes
  • Long-term corticosteroid usage
  • Farsightedness
  • High blood pressure
  • Previous eye damage or surgery
  • Glaucoma can develop for a variety of reasons, including diabetes.

Glaucoma treatment

  • Medication: Several eye drops are recommended for the treatment of glaucoma. In order to improve eye pressure, several eye drops are administered to reduce fluid and promote outflow. You are advised to use these eye drops permanently because glaucoma is a chronic condition for which there is no cure. Only preventing it from becoming worse is possible.
  • Laser therapy: A laser is utilised to help your eye's fluid discharge.
